Legacy Veterinary Clinic founded by Dr. Kaveh Sarhangpour who aims to provide conscious care for community pet families. This sustainable clinic provides general and specialized care.

The vision is to keep wellness in mind for pets, people and planet in all endeavors. The clinic has been designed with this intention, and all efforts are made to stay true to nature with day to day choices.

The Clinic’s goal is to bring academic grade medicine to our community in a cost conscious manner. Our highly qualified veterinarians and staff strive to find the root cause of pets’ warning signals (symptoms) and ailments saving valuable time, money and resources for all.

Dr. Kaveh Sarhangpour

Founder / Medical Director

Dr. Kaveh Sarhangpour received his DVM degree in 1987. Dr. Sarhangpour has had over two decades of experience, both in academic and clinical settings. He has been a veterinarian in Colorado since 1997 and continues to serve his community today as he holds membership in various professional societies in the US and Europe.

  • European Society of Veterinary Internal Medicine (ESVIM)
  • Society for Comparative Endocrinology (SCE)
  • Comparative Gastroenterology Society (CGS)
  • European Society of Veterinary Nephrology and Urology (ESVNU)
  • International Veterinary Senior Care Society (IVSCS)

On the clinical side, in addition to his veterinary work, he has helped area veterinarians with advanced ultrasound diagnostics and consultation services. Dr. Sarhangpour also holds accredited continuing education courses for veterinarians in Colorado.

He is passionate about improving quality of life for his patients and clients. Among his favorite recreational activities are playing soccer in a league, enjoying mountain and outdoor activities, and spending time with his family doing various activities such as community gardening, and cultural events.

Dr. Jennifer Foltz

DVM

Dr. Jennifer Foltz joined Legacy Veterinary Clinic in November of 2017. She grew up in Wheat Ridge, Colorado. She developed a passion for veterinary medicine while caring for her childhood pets, including dogs, rabbits, frogs, and lizards. She earned her Bachelor of Science in Biology from Colorado State University in 2009 followed by her Doctorate of Veterinary Medicine from Colorado State University in 2016. She then worked for a small animal clinic in the area for a year before joining the team at Legacy. Her veterinary interests include internal medicine, soft tissue surgery, and preventative care.

In her free time, she enjoys snowboarding, hiking, and camping in the beautiful Colorado mountains and spending time with her husband, daughter, and two dogs.

Dr. Matthew Khorsand

DVM

Dr. Khorsand grew up in Illinois where he spent most of his time outdoors fishing, boating, and hanging

out with friends. He grew up with Golden Retrievers, hamsters, gerbils, and lizards. Matt always seemed to find and take in animals that were dumped outside his neighborhood which included a farm duck, cat, and St. Bernard.

After high school, he earned a B.S. in Biology with a minor in Chemistry at University of Illinois at Chicago. During his time at University of Illinois at Chicago he rescued a puppy he named Kaya. She changed his course in life from human medicine to veterinary medicine.  After this, Dr. Khorsand attended Ross University School of Veterinary Medicine where he graduated summa cum laude. During his time at Ross, he did a veterinary externship in Costa Rica where he performed spays, neuters, and educated locals about the importance of animal welfare and well-being. He spent his clinical year at Colorado State University where he stayed and work for their Sports Medicine and Rehabilitation Department. He also performed a small animal rotating internship at Cornell University.

Matt enjoys all aspects of veterinary medicine but has a strong interest in Cardiology, ultrasound, and internal medicine.

He enjoys snowboarding, fishing, hiking with Bjorn, his Greater Swiss Mountain dog, camping, kayaking, and spending time with friends and family.
